Deleted Added
full compact
eventtimers.4 (232920) eventtimers.4 (247812)
1.\" Copyright (c) 2010 Alexander Motin <mav@FreeBSD.org>
2.\" All rights reserved.
3.\"
4.\" Redistribution and use in source and binary forms, with or without
5.\" modification, are permitted provided that the following conditions
6.\" are met:
7.\" 1. Redistributions of source code must retain the above copyright
8.\" notice, this list of conditions and the following disclaimer.

--- 8 unchanged lines hidden (view full) ---

17.\" FOR ANY DIRECT, INDIRECT, IN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L
18.\" DAMAGES (INCLUDING, B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S
19.\" OR SERVICES; L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ION)
20.\" HOWEVER C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T
21.\" L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Y
22.\" O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F
23.\" SUCH DAMAGE.
24.\"
1.\" Copyright (c) 2010 Alexander Motin <mav@FreeBSD.org>
2.\" All rights reserved.
3.\"
4.\" Redistribution and use in source and binary forms, with or without
5.\" modification, are permitted provided that the following conditions
6.\" are met:
7.\" 1. Redistributions of source code must retain the above copyright
8.\" notice, this list of conditions and the following disclaimer.

--- 8 unchanged lines hidden (view full) ---

17.\" FOR ANY DIRECT, INDIRECT, IN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L
18.\" DAMAGES (INCLUDING, B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S
19.\" OR SERVICES; L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ION)
20.\" HOWEVER C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T
21.\" L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Y
22.\" O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F
23.\" SUCH DAMAGE.
24.\"
25.\" $FreeBSD: head/share/man/man4/eventtimers.4 232920 2012-03-13 10:54:14Z mav $
25.\" $FreeBSD: head/share/man/man4/eventtimers.4 247812 2013-03-04 19:10:39Z davide $
26.\"
27.Dd March 13, 2012
28.Dt EVENTTIMERS 4
29.Os
30.Sh NAME
31.Nm eventtimers
32.Nd kernel event timers subsystem
33.Sh SYNOPSIS

--- 104 unchanged lines hidden (view full) ---

1381, 2 or 4, depending on configured HZ value.
139.It Va kern.eventtimer.idletick
140makes each CPU to receive every timer interrupt independently of whether they
141busy or not.
142By default this options is disabled.
143If chosen timer is per-CPU
144and runs in periodic mode, this option has no effect - all interrupts are
145always generating.
26.\"
27.Dd March 13, 2012
28.Dt EVENTTIMERS 4
29.Os
30.Sh NAME
31.Nm eventtimers
32.Nd kernel event timers subsystem
33.Sh SYNOPSIS

--- 104 unchanged lines hidden (view full) ---

1381, 2 or 4, depending on configured HZ value.
139.It Va kern.eventtimer.idletick
140makes each CPU to receive every timer interrupt independently of whether they
141busy or not.
142By default this options is disabled.
143If chosen timer is per-CPU
144and runs in periodic mode, this option has no effect - all interrupts are
145always generating.
146.It Va kern.eventtimer.activetick
147makes each CPU to receive all kinds of timer interrupts when they are busy.
148Disabling it allows to skip some
149.Fn hardclock
150calls in some cases.
151By default this options is enabled.
152If chosen timer is per-CPU, this option has no effect - all interrupts are
153always generating, as timer reprogramming is too expensive for that case.
154.El
155.Sh SEE ALSO
156.Xr apic 4 ,
157.Xr atrtc 4 ,
158.Xr attimer 4 ,
159.Xr hpet 4 ,
160.Xr timecounters 4 ,
161.Xr eventtimers 9
146.El
147.Sh SEE ALSO
148.Xr apic 4 ,
149.Xr atrtc 4 ,
150.Xr attimer 4 ,
151.Xr hpet 4 ,
152.Xr timecounters 4 ,
153.Xr eventtimers 9